These Pokémon are created when spirits possess rotten tree stumps. They prefer to live in abandoned forests.
According to old tales, these Pokémon are stumps possessed by the spirits of children who died while lost in the forest.
Phantump Weakness
Phantump is weak to Fire, Ice, Flying, Ghost, and Dark. On the flip side, it's immune to Normal and Fighting-type moves entirely. It resists 4 types, giving it decent defensive coverage.
| Damage | Types |
|---|---|
| 2x (Weak) | Fire, Ice, Flying, Ghost, Dark |
| 0.5x (Resist) | Water, Electric, Grass, Ground |
| 0x (Immune) | Normal, Fighting |

Phantump evolves into Trevenant by trading. One evolution, no branching. Solid jump from 309 BST.
In Omega Ruby & Alpha Sapphire, Phantump does the job early-game if you need a Ghost/Grass type on your team. Evolve it into Trevenant before the later gyms and it holds up fine through the story.
